The Portuguese word "corte" can mean "cut" (as in an incision or act of cutting) or "court" (as in a royal court or court of law), depending on context.


In this sentence, 'corte' refers to a wound or injury, illustrating its use as a noun to describe a physical cut.

O corte na minha mão já está melhorando.

The cut on my hand is already improving.


Here, 'corte' is used to describe the result of the action of cutting something, specifically a hairstyle, showing its application in the context of grooming.

O cabeleireiro fez um corte impecável no meu cabelo.

The hairstylist made an impeccable cut on my hair.


In this context, 'corte' denotes a reduction, emphasizing its figurative usage to describe a lowering in allocation or amount of resources.

Ela enfrentou o corte de verbas do governo.

She faced the budget cuts from the government.
